tdishon 02-17-2022 02:59 PM

5 Attachment(s)
Doors are next.
Love the new door handles I came across. Knuckle pockets are next for the door handle. I know everybody has different tastes, but I was never a fan of the factory door handles.
Electric door latches off 2020 Corvette and Nu-relics power windows with factory looking interior handle switch for both door and window.

Are those magnets holding the tailgate shut?

tdishon 04-16-2022 09:22 PM

Quote:

Originally Posted by WSSix (Post 718393)
Are those magnets holding the tailgate shut?

No, they are rubber bumpers to keep everything tight and no rattles. The beds on old trucks were rattle traps. That's why the whole bed has been welded together and the latches changed. No chains or scissor opener. It has a Hammer Fab flipper stop. Works great.
